DC Magnetic Field Health Concerns


A review of available literature and research regarding possible human health risks associated with exposure to DC (Static) magnetic fields, reveals limited concern except in very high DC field environments.

The International Commission on Non-Ionizing Radiation Protection. "Guidelines on limits of Exposure to Static Magnetic Fields". Health Physics 66: 100-106 (1994) states the following:

  • People become nauseous, develop taste in mouth, vertigo, and magnetophosphenes (flickering sensation in the eyes) at 4 T (40 G)
  • Pacemakers can malfunction @ at 3.1 G (this is from a German report for an unspecified model of pacemaker, most pacemakers specify higher fields to malfunction)
  • Circadian rhythms are affected by merely rotating Earth's 1/2 G dc field
  • Pacemaker warnings usually start at 5 G with manufacturers warning at 10 G
  • Precautions for users of metallic prostheses at 30 G
  • Precautions for metal tools at 30 G
  • Overexposures are unlikely, but fields which could be hazardous to pacemaker users or cause problems for prostheses and tool users are much more likely to be found.

The majority of concerns, both for possible health risk and safety, seem to be centered around NMR and MRI imaging systems and/or similar devices, which utilize very powerful DC magnets. Manufactures of such equipment usually provide guidelines for establishing a "5 G line" around the devices and caution that persons with pacemakers or other implanted medical devices, should stay clear of the 5 G line. An "attractive force hazard" also exists wherein nearby metallic objects can be "drawn" toward the powerful magnets and in some instances at dangerous or even fatal velocity and force. Such attractive force hazards typically include:

  • Tools & compressed gas cylinders
  • Prosthetic implants made of magnetizable materials (this can include machined stainless steel)
  • Jewelry and some watches
  • Credit cards & badges (beginning at ~10 G)

NMR and MRI manufactures also urge users of prostheses which contain metal be checked before entering areas where DC magnetic field levels exceed 30G.
